A big change is coming to Vermont's largest mountain resort, as Killington Resort announced on Thursday that it is being sold to local owners later this year. Both Killington Resort and Pico ...
Vermont’s Killington Resort, the largest mountain resort in New England, announced Thursday that Killington Resort and Pico Mountain are being sold from POWDR to a group of local pass holders.
Active-duty, retired, and honorably discharged members of the U.S. military are eligible for discounted lift tickets to Killington Resort. You'll be required to verify your military status during ...
Resort officials are reminding people about what they should keep in mind during national ski safety awareness month.
using the phrase “mom n’ pop” to describe the mountain doesn’t feel apt. Killington, as you North Easterners know, is a ...